Transaction 43221584537e6541b31872066baf0b24fc2dacd7859e34a5b84cb1ba59a7dd84
1 Input
1 Output
-
43221584537e6541b31872066baf0b24fc2dacd7859e34a5b84cb1ba59a7dd84:0
- value
- 496778
- script pubkey
- OP_0 OP_PUSHBYTES_20 cef1c2407bcc31cd6ea3ce9ab1e55423e84e87d3
- address
- bc1qemcuysrmescu6m4re6dtre25y05yap7nscnd2s